Speeding-up the discrete wavelet transform computation with multicore and GPU-based algorithms

被引:1
|
作者
Galiano, V. [1 ]
Lopez, O. [1 ]
Malumbres, M. P. [1 ]
Migallon, H. [1 ]
机构
[1] Miguel Hernandez Univ, Phys & Comp Architecture Dept, Elche 03202, Spain
关键词
Wavelet transform; OpenMP; CUDA; image coding; parallel algorithms; LIFTING SCHEME; IMAGE CODEC; CONSTRUCTION; MEMORY; DESIGN;
D O I
10.3233/978-1-61499-041-3-151
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In this work we propose several parallel algorithms to compute the twodimensional discrete wavelet transform (2D-DWT), exploiting the available hardware resources. In particular, we will explore OpenMP optimized versions of 2D-DWT over a multicore platform and we will also develop CUDA-based 2D-DWT algorithms which are able to run on GPUs (Graphics Processing Unit). The proposed algorithms are based on several 2D-DWT computation approaches as (1) filter-bank convolution, (2) lifting transform and (3) matrix convolution, so we can determine which of them better adapts to our parallel versions. All proposed algorithms are based on the Daubechies 9/7 filter which is widely used in image/video compression.
引用
收藏
页码:151 / 158
页数:8
相关论文
共 50 条
  • [1] GPU-based data processing for speeding-up correlation plenoptic imaging
    Santoro, Francesca
    Petrelli, Isabella
    Massaro, Gianlorenzo
    Filios, George
    Pepe, Francesco V.
    Amoruso, Leonardo
    Ieronymaki, Maria
    Burri, Samuel
    Charbon, Edoardo
    Mos, Paul
    Ulku, Arin
    Wayne, Michael
    Abbattista, Cristoforo
    Bruschini, Claudio
    D'Angelo, Milena
    EUROPEAN PHYSICAL JOURNAL PLUS, 2024, 139 (12):
  • [2] Speeding-up of fractal image coding by wavelet transform
    Yuan, Liyu
    Li, Shaofa
    Huanan Ligong Daxue Xuebao/Journal of South China University of Technology (Natural Science), 1999, 27 (12): : 79 - 83
  • [3] Speeding-up Fast Fourier Transform
    El-Motaz, Mohammed A.
    El-Shafiey, Ahmed M.
    Farag, Mohamed E.
    Nasr, Omar A.
    Fahmy, Hossam A. H.
    2015 IEEE CONFERENCE ON ELECTRONICS, CIRCUITS, AND SYSTEMS (ICECS), 2015, : 510 - 511
  • [4] A STRATEGY FOR SPEEDING-UP THE COMPUTATION OF CHARACTERISTIC SETS
    WANG, DM
    LECTURE NOTES IN COMPUTER SCIENCE, 1992, 629 : 504 - 510
  • [5] Speeding-Up Elliptic Curve Cryptography Algorithms
    Maimut, Diana
    Matei, Alexandru Cristian
    MATHEMATICS, 2022, 10 (19)
  • [6] CLIQUE PARTITIONS, GRAPH COMPRESSION AND SPEEDING-UP ALGORITHMS
    FEDER, T
    MOTWANI, R
    JOURNAL OF COMPUTER AND SYSTEM SCIENCES, 1995, 51 (02) : 261 - 272
  • [7] Speeding-up Construction Algorithms for the Graph Coloring Problem
    Kanahara, Kazuho
    Katayama, Kengo
    Miyake, Takafumi
    Tomita, Etsuji
    IEICE TRANSACTIONS ON FUNDAMENTALS OF ELECTRONICS COMMUNICATIONS AND COMPUTER SCIENCES, 2022, E105 (08)
  • [8] SPEEDING-UP 2 STRING-MATCHING ALGORITHMS
    CROCHEMORE, M
    CZUMAJ, A
    GASIENIEC, L
    JAROMINEK, S
    LECROQ, T
    PLANDOWSKI, W
    RYTTER, W
    ALGORITHMICA, 1994, 12 (4-5) : 247 - 267
  • [9] Speeding-Up Construction Algorithms for the Graph Coloring Problem
    Kanahara, Kazuho
    Katayama, Kengo
    Tomita, Etsuji
    IEICE TRANSACTIONS ON FUNDAMENTALS OF ELECTRONICS COMMUNICATIONS AND COMPUTER SCIENCES, 2022, E105A (09) : 1241 - 1251
  • [10] Speeding-up node influence computation for huge social networks
    Kimura M.
    Saito K.
    Ohara K.
    Motoda H.
    International Journal of Data Science and Analytics, 2016, 1 (1) : 3 - 16